Deep Dive

1. Community Fund Annual Distribution (September 2026)

Overview: According to the token distribution schedule, 10 million MBX is allocated annually from the Community Fund every September through 2026 (MARBLEX Docs). This fund is designed to reward contributions that drive ecosystem activity, such as staking services, to increase Total Value Locked (TVL) and token utility. The next scheduled distribution is for September 2026.

What this means: This is neutral for MBX as it represents a planned, non-inflationary release aimed at incentivizing usage. It could support price if the rewards successfully boost engagement and TVL, but it also constitutes a scheduled unlock that the market has long anticipated.

2. Stablecoin Development with Toss (No Date)

Overview: MARBLEX is in early-stage preparations to launch a Korean Won-pegged stablecoin in partnership with fintech giant Toss (CoinMarketCap). Trademarks like "KRWV" have been filed, indicating intent. The goal is to create a stable financial layer for Netmarble's gaming ecosystem, facilitating seamless in-game payments and reducing volatility exposure for users.

What this means: This is bullish for MBX because a successful stablecoin could significantly increase utility and transaction volume within the MARBLEX ecosystem, driving demand for the native token. However, it's a long-term initiative facing major regulatory and execution risks in South Korea's strict crypto environment.

Deep Dive

1. MBX Bridge Integration on Layerswap (9 July 2025)

Overview: This update connected MARBLEX's native Kaia network with the Immutable zkEVM blockchain. It allows users to move MBX tokens between these chains in seconds, removing a major friction point for players and developers.

The integration is a technical upgrade that relies on Layerswap's bridging infrastructure. It doesn't require users to interact with complex decentralized exchange (DEX) interfaces or manage multiple wallets, streamlining the process to participate in games on Immutable.

What this means: This is bullish for MBX because it makes the ecosystem more accessible and usable. Players can move their tokens faster and with less hassle, which could lead to more activity and demand for MBX across different games and platforms. (MARBLEX)

2. Meta Toy DragonZ Saga Game Launch (August 2025)

Overview: This was the full integration and launch of the "Meta Toy DragonZ Saga" game into the MARBLEX ecosystem. It involved deploying the game's smart contracts and connecting its in-game economy, including NFTs and rewards, to the MBX token.

The launch followed a pre-registration campaign and included quests and events designed to drive user engagement and token utility directly within a playable environment.

What this means: This is bullish for MBX because it adds a major, active use case. A live game with hundreds of collectible dragons creates sustained demand for the token through gameplay, NFT purchases, and rewards, directly linking entertainment value to the crypto asset. (Kanalcoin)

3. Web3 Gaming Hackathon Launch (5 June 2025)

Overview: MARBLEX, through its parent company, launched the "MBX/HACK the FUN" hackathon in partnership with Dracoon Ventures. This initiative involved providing developer tools, software development kits (SDKs), and technical workshops to build new games and projects on the MARBLEX infrastructure.

The event was a development-focused effort to expand the ecosystem's technical breadth by incentivizing external developers to build on its platform, testing and potentially improving the underlying developer experience.
